Elevator system and supporting column assembly thereof
An elevator system and a support column assembly. The elevator system includes a support column, with the bottom end thereof connected to a bottom mounting base, and the top end thereof connected to a top mounting base; a counterweight arranged in the support column; a car having a through hole penetrating in a vertical direction, wherein the car is arranged around the support column via the through hole; and a traction assembly, wherein the car is connected to the counterweight via the traction assembly, and the car and the counterweight reciprocate along the length direction of the support column under the traction of the traction assembly.
Ropeless elevator propulsion system
According to an embodiment, an elevator system including: a beam climber system configured to move an elevator car through an elevator shaft by climbing a first guide beam that extends vertically through the elevator shaft, the first guide beam including a first surface and a second surface opposite the first surface, the beam climber system including: a first wheel; a second wheel; a first traction belt wrapped around the first wheel and the second wheel, the first traction belt being in contact with the first surface; and a first electric motor configured to rotate the first wheel, wherein the first traction belt is configured to rotate when the first wheel rotates.
Inverter parameter based hydraulic system control device
The present invention relates to a control device for pressure control in a hydraulic system, especially of an elevator-system, the control device is adapted to control an output variable of an inverter supplying a hydraulic pump of the hydraulic system with electric energy, the output variable is adapted to adjust the speed of the hydraulic pump in order to at least partly compensate for a leakage of operating fluid in the hydraulic pump. Further, the invention relates to an elevator-system that includes a hydraulic pump, an inverter, and a control device which controls a supply of the hydraulic pump with electric energy from the inverter. Moreover, the invention relates to a method for pressure control in a hydraulic system, especially of an elevator-system, the method that includes the steps of supplying a hydraulic pump of the hydraulic system with electric energy from an inverter, controlling at least one output variable of the inverter for adjusting the speed of the hydraulic pump, in order to at least partly compensate for a leakage of operating fluid in the hydraulic pump. For providing an inexpensive elevating solution with good right quality for hydraulic elevators, the present invention provides that the control device includes a computing module which is adapted to determine the output variable based on at least one inverter parameter.
MAGNETIC ELEVATOR DRIVE MEMBER AND METHOD OF MANUFACTURE
An illustrative example method of making a magnetic drive component includes inserting a plurality of metal teeth into a metal tube. The teeth respectively have a first portion received against an inner surface of the tube. The teeth respectively have a second portion and a third portion spaced apart and projecting toward a center of the tube. The method includes securing the plurality of teeth to the tube.
Elevator drive machinery and elevator
The invention relates to an a drive machinery for an elevator, the drive machinery comprising a rotatable drive sheave for driving plurality of ropes of the elevator, the drive sheave comprising a central cylinder, which comprises a central axis around which the central cylinder is rotatable; plurality of circular rim members surrounding the central cylinder, each said rim member comprising an outer rim surface for engaging a rope. Said plurality of circular rim members includes one or more rotatably mounted circular rim members, each said rotatably mounted circular rim member being mounted on the central cylinder rotatably around said central axis relative to the central cylinder and relative to one or more of the other circular rim members, and in that said drive sheave moreover comprises a control means for controlling rotation of each said rotatably mounted circular rim member relative to the central cylinder and relative to one or more of the other circular rim members. The invention also relates to an elevator implementing the drive machinery.
AUTONOMOUS ELEVATOR CAR MOVER CONFIGURED WITH GUIDE WHEELS
Disclosed is a car mover, configured for autonomously moving an elevator car along a track beam in a hoistway lane, having: a car mover body; a drive wheel operationally connected a lateral side of the car mover body, and configured to rotate about a drive wheel axis; a first guide wheel operationally connected to the lateral side of the car mover body, wherein the first guide wheel is offset from the drive wheel so that, in operation: the first guide wheel engages a lateral sidewall of the track beam when the drive wheel laterally moves on the track beam, to thereby restrict lateral motion of the drive wheel on the track beam.
ROPELESS ELEVATOR LOCKOUT AND CONFIRMATION OF AUTONOMOUS VEHICLES IN TRANSFER STATION
A system for transferring elevator cars from a first elevator shaft to a second elevator shaft including: a propulsion system configured to move an elevator car through the first elevator shaft and the second elevator shaft; a transfer carriage configured to move the elevator car from the first elevator shaft to the second elevator shaft through a transfer station, the transfer carriage including: an elevator car containment slot to receive the elevator car; and a car retention mechanism configured to secure the elevator car and the propulsion system within the transfer carriage while the transfer carriage moves from the first elevator shaft to the second elevator shaft, wherein the propulsion system is configured to move the elevator car from an elevator system within the first elevator shaft onto the transfer carriage and off the transfer carriage to an elevator system within the second elevator shaft.
